Full steam ahead for Cowes Week 2010

When: 31 July – 7 August 2024

Where: Cowes, Isle of Wight

Details: Cowes on the Isle of Wight will come to life from 31 July – 7 August as one of the UK’s longest running sporting events and the world’s best-known sailing regatta begins. Cowes is expecting more than 100,000 spectators, over 8,000 competitors and up to 1,000 boats racing in over 40 different classes to grace its shores this summer.

The week promises to be exciting with the hugely anticipated 1851 Cup bringing together the British America’s Cup team, TEAMORIGIN, and current defenders of the America’s Cup trophy, US team BMW ORACLE Racing, for some spectacular match racing. Also watch out for the Extreme Sailing Series where the dynamic Extreme 40 catamarans will race at up to 45mph, within inches of the shoreline.

If watching all the action isn’t enough for you, you can try dipping your toe in the water with Try Sailing. Under the guiding hand of qualified instructors from the UKSA, complete beginners can enjoy a sailing taster lesson for just £5. Or, if you are feeling competitive, why not have a go at ‘Come Racing’ – an initiative that enables you to have a go at racing on a Laser SB3 with a professional skipper after the main Cowes Week fleets have finished for the day, for only £10!

For those of you that haven’t found your sea legs there is also plenty to do onshore; throughout the week live music and entertainment will be provided. The finale for the week’s entertainment is on Friday with a show-stopping Red Arrows display followed by the renowned Cowes Week Fireworks.
